Sonnertsham
Sonnertsham is a hamlet in Zeilarn, Rottal-Inn, Bavaria. Sonnertsham is situated nearby to the hamlet Haus, as well as near the village Schildthurn.Places of Interest
Highlights include St. Ägidius.

Tann is a municipality in the district of Rottal-Inn in Bavaria, Germany. It has about 4,000 inhabitants and is 15 km from the corner of Austria away. Notable sites include the historic marketplace and the church St. Tann is situated 2½ km northeast of Sonnertsham.
